Output fcddaaccb6b9b4fe708d15d8b1e5aa160270f9992fbebbf71f6500fab9c05635:10

value
30311
script pubkey
OP_0 OP_PUSHBYTES_20 8b85aa25f32e1484ba8a6f4ca4f125438573e6e2
address
bc1q3wz65f0n9c2gfw52dax2fuf9gwzh8ehzpr8g85
transaction
fcddaaccb6b9b4fe708d15d8b1e5aa160270f9992fbebbf71f6500fab9c05635
confirmations
18931
spent
true